Hui Gong

Hui Gong Email and Phone Number

Alibaba Cloud - Technical Specialist @ Alibaba Cloud
hangzhou, zhejiang, china
Hui Gong's Location
Pudong, Shanghai, China, China
Hui Gong's Contact Details

Hui Gong work email

Hui Gong personal email

About Hui Gong

1. Experience in software development under Linux, QNX, FreeRTOS, VxWorks, Windows, uC-OS.2. Proficient in multi-thread process technology, be good at design of distributed systems.3. Strong knowledge of C/C++, be familiar with C#.4. Strong experience with TCP/IP, CANopen and other communication protocols, experience in communication protocols designing.5. Experience in driver and protocol stack development.6. Skilled in Object-Oriented Design & Object-Oriented Programming, be familiar with UML.7. Experience in software implement in System Control, Motion Control System.8. Experience in HMI design and implement via Qt, C#, MFC.9. Knowledge in agile methodology and tools, deep understand of Software Development Life Cycle.10. Skilled in Clear Case, SVN and other software configuration management tools for large-scale collaborative software development.11. Experience in software static test, unit test, proficient in all the test design.12. Good teamwork spirits and communication skills, as well as software project team leadership.13. Knowledge of Medical Electronics and Railway Signaling techniques.

Hui Gong's Current Company Details
Alibaba Cloud

Alibaba Cloud

View
Alibaba Cloud - Technical Specialist
hangzhou, zhejiang, china
Website:
aliyun.com
Employees:
2157
Hui Gong Work Experience Details
  • Alibaba Cloud
    Technical Specialist
    Alibaba Cloud Apr 2018 - Present
    Shanghai City, China
    Hybrid Cloud Storage Development, Technology stack focus on backend service, which usually implemented via c++, Golang, etc
  • Beijing Surgerii Technology Co., Ltd.
    Head Of Software
    Beijing Surgerii Technology Co., Ltd. Feb 2017 - Apr 2018
    Shanghai
    Head of software department. Focus on software team management, architecture of system control and movement control.
  • Siemens Healthineers
    Lead Software Engineer
    Siemens Healthineers Jan 2017 - Feb 2017
    Shanghai City, China
    Highlight:1. Leading Transferring from QNX to Linux for Medical Platform.2. Introduced Qt to SIEMENS Medical as HMI.3. Architect a dual-path security protect for motion control.
  • Siemens Healthcare
    Senior Software Engineer
    Siemens Healthcare Jan 2015 - Jan 2017
    Shanghai City, China
    Develop of System Control, Motion Control and HMI for next generation Radiography products. Detail as below:1. Take the System Control of Radiography products based on Embedded-Linux.2. Take the Dual-Loop control of servo motor for 6-Axis high precision control. A distribute control strategy devised consider the safety, cost-down and flexibility: Master-Local Control mechanism: Slave Program running in uC-OS II and Cortex M4 to collect Position Value and perform Motor Control, which communicates with Master Program with CAN; Master Program running in Embedded-Linux & Cortex-A9, to perform the Motion Logical and communicates with other sub-system.3. Introduce Qt under Linux into project to instead of before HMI based on WinCE, accept by Project and take the Architecture Design, implemented the first version prototype.
  • Siemens Healthcare
    Software Engineer
    Siemens Healthcare Apr 2012 - Jan 2015
    Shanghai City, China
    Be responsible for software development of system control. The main product is X-Ray Control Unit, which is a core control unit in medical diagnosis equipment. My main responsibility is the development for the next generation device. New function added in this work includes replacing the ARCNET into CANopen, new communication protocol is devised to improve the reliability of the system, additional telegram is added to enhance the system availability, CANopen stack protocol is developed for communicating with other components. Technology used in current work is C++ development under QNX embed system & Windows. Enterprise Architect is the tool accomplished designing, Clear Case & Clear Quest are used for version control and bug trace. Agile development model is used to improve the development efficiency and responsiveness.
  • Insigma Technology Co., Ltd
    Senior Software Development Engineer
    Insigma Technology Co., Ltd May 2010 - Apr 2012
    Hangzhou, Zhejiang, P.R.C.
    1. Participate in the system software architecture designing, take responsibility for the software architecture and codes implementation. 2. Focus on the CUP core module design including multi-machine synchronization, voting, scheduling, and diagnostic processing. 3. Solve the technological problem of multi-machine communication synchronization. 4. A new design patterns is introduced to reduce coupling between function modules. 5. Coding standards is in line with Misra C++ 2008 coding rule. 6. Hold on the design review and function testing with V&V team. 7. Provide system test & integrating test training to test team and new numbers.
  • Casco Signal
    Software Development Engineer
    Casco Signal May 2008 - May 2010
    Shanghai
    1. Participate in composing the requirements specification, structure design and module design documents. 2. Realize the function programming using C language. 3. Cooperate with test engineers and QA to ensure the correctness of the system.4. Coding to realize the software functions and processing unit test with test engineers.

Hui Gong Skills

Linux Software Development Clearcase C++ C Uml Agile Methodologies Design Patterns Oop Vxworks Git Multithreading Tcp/ip Unit Testing C/c++ Windows Ooa Ood C# Canopen Qnx Qt Uc Os Motion Control Uc/os Ii Medical Devices

Hui Gong Education Details

Frequently Asked Questions about Hui Gong

What company does Hui Gong work for?

Hui Gong works for Alibaba Cloud

What is Hui Gong's role at the current company?

Hui Gong's current role is Alibaba Cloud - Technical Specialist.

What is Hui Gong's email address?

Hui Gong's email address is hi****@****ail.com

What schools did Hui Gong attend?

Hui Gong attended Tianjin University, Tianjin University.

What are some of Hui Gong's interests?

Hui Gong has interest in Etc, Photography, Electronic Products, Pingpong, Software Development Technology, Electronic Shopping.

What skills is Hui Gong known for?

Hui Gong has skills like Linux, Software Development, Clearcase, C++, C, Uml, Agile Methodologies, Design Patterns, Oop, Vxworks, Git, Multithreading.

Who are Hui Gong's colleagues?

Hui Gong's colleagues are 夏启东xia, Feifei Dai, Xiang Li, 金建明, Wayne(Wenzhi) Qin, Leah Wang, Jojo Zhou.

Not the Hui Gong you were looking for?

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.